Photograph of the 1957 Eureka College graduation ceremony during Ronald Reagan's visit to Eureka College at which he attended the commencement for the graduates. Ronald Reagan attended Eureka College between 1928 and 1932. He was a member of the TKE's Iota Chapter during his time in Eureka and served as its President in 1928. Reagan was also active in school including theater and football. At the time of the photograph, Ronald Reagan was working as an actor in Hollywood. As one of Eureka College's most famous celebrity, Reagan's arrival to campus was always celebrated by staff, faculty, students, Eureka College Alums, and the citizens of Eureka.
This black and white photograph shows a profile view of attendees of the Eureka College graduation ceremony standing out on the grass of Eureka College. There are several in attendance wearing nice clothes as expected of attendees to the event. There are several women in each row wearing dresses, while the men in attendance wear suits and ties, and the children wear dresses and button-up shirts to match the adults. The identities of those in attendance are unknown, but it is known that none of those pictures are Ronald Reagan.
